Description
Park Inn by Radisson, a renowned hotel chain, sought to enhance its sustainability efforts and reduce operational costs by installing a solar panel system at one of its properties.
Challenges
- High Energy Demand: The hotel's extensive facilities, including guest rooms, restaurants, and common areas, resulted in substantial electricity consumption.
- Space Limitations: Limited rooftop space for solar panel installation, requiring efficient design and utilization.
- Capital Investment: The upfront cost of acquiring and installing the solar panel system.
- Operational Integration: Seamless integration of the solar panel system with existing hotel operations and infrastructure.
Solutions
- Customized Design: Developed a solar panel system design tailored to the hotel's energy requirements and available rooftop area.
- Efficient Utilization: Utilized advanced solar panel technology to maximize energy production within space constraints.
- Financial Strategy: Devised a financing strategy to manage the initial investment and optimize return on investment.
- Operational Integration: Integrated the solar panel system with the hotel's energy management system for seamless operation and monitoring.
Solar System Capacity
- System Size: 96 kWp
